The largest earthquake ever





About 1,665 killed people, 3,000 injured, 2,000,000 homeless and 550 million dollars damage are the frightening digits from the largest eartqueake ever happened. It occured in Valdivia, Chile and there´s never been any eartquake as powerful as this, so far.

Severe damage from shaking occurred in the Valdivia-Puerto Montt area. Most of the casualties and much of the damage was because of large tsunamis which caused damage along the coast of Chile from Lebu to Puerto Aisen and in many areas of the Pacific Ocean. Puerto Saavedra was completely destroyed by waves which reached heights of 11.5 m (38 ft) and carried remains of houses inland as much as 3 km (2 mi). Wave heights of 8 m (26 ft) caused much damage at Corral. Despite the destructive description about this earthquake. it´s not the most deadly earthqueake.
